Zero and Negative Exponents
Raising a Number to the Zero Power Anything raised to the zero power is 1, except 0 to
the zero power. 0 to the zero power is undefined.
Negative Exponents
A negative exponent is telling you to divide by that number – or find the reciprocal of that number, then raise it to the power indicated.
For example, 5-2 is telling you to divide by 52 or to flip 5 2 ( ), then square the 5 → ( ).
In the case of variables, you can just move it from top (numerator) to bottom (denominator) or vice versa.
